Creating my own Outlook e-mail address
I recently purchased Microsoft Enterprise 2007. I am trying to familiarize
myself with Outlook 2007 as I am fairly adept with Outllook 2003. But I have a question that will sound rather boneheaded for somebody who is supposedly computer savvy, especially with Outlook, Excel, Word... In my previous experience with ANY Microsoft applications, the portal was provided by an employer's Administrator, so I already had an Outlook e-mail address provided for me. In this case, I am the Administrator. How do I create my Outlook e-mail address? Or did I already do this in the heady rush to get my new toy activated and simply forgot? Creating my own Outlook e-mail address
To obtain an email address you need a mail provider. There are generally
three types of mail providers: - free, web-based accounts (Yahoo, Hotmail, Gmail) - an account provided by your ISP - an account provided by your employer's mail admin You cannot have a mail address by Outlook alone, it needs a mail server that can be found on the Internet, and that handles your incoming & outgoing mail messages.
